WebMar 26, 2016 · Fifths. Fifths are pairs of notes separated by five lines and spaces. Fifths are pretty easy to recognize in notation, because they’re two notes that are exactly two lines or two spaces apart. Keeping up with recommended service intervals will prolong the life of your RockShox … WebApr 20, 2024 · Why a perfect 5th is considered the most consonant interval other than the octave has to do with how the waveforms of the pitches interact with each other. Assuming a sine wave (no harmonics, pure tone) for each pitch, the combination of two pitches will create more or less complex patterns depending on the interval.
